How big does Callisia repens get?

Callisia repens (Creeping Inchplant) - A low growing evergreen perennial to 4 inches tall and spreading to 4 feet or more on stems that root at the joints. The 1 inch long soft downy leaves are dark green above and rich purple below. Small white flowers appear in late spring or early summer.

What potting mix for Callisia repens?

Soil. A standard potting mix will do for growing Callisia repens. Like with many other plant species, it is beneficial to have a mix that's well aerated and well-draining. There must be a good combination of soil, organic materials and draining amendments.

Is Callisia repens a succulent?

Callisia repens, also known as creeping inchplant or turtle vine, is a succulent creeping plant from the family Commelinaceae. This species comes from Central and South America.

Why do Callisia repens turn brown?

These issues are commonly down to either too much heat/light forgetfulness. Dehydration is the number one issue among growers, so always keep an eye out for drying soil. Over-watering symptoms, on the other hand, include yellowing lower leaves, little to no growth and a rotting stem or leaves.

Does Callisia repens climb?

Plants succeed in very shallow soils and will happily grow over stony ground and climb up stone walls, enabling Callisia repens to easily colonise new areas of ground.
